I would love to bag one of those bucks at Rifle Camp or Garrets Mt., but then again where is the real sport of shooting a deer that is so use to humans, that they would walk up to you and be hand fed? Might as well hunt a zoo.
Posted:  04 Feb 2007 12:25 PM
Quote:
I would love to bag one of those bucks at Rifle Camp or Garrets Mt., but then again where is the real sport of shooting a deer that is so use to humans, that they would walk up to you and be hand fed? Might as well hunt a zoo


On management hunt I participate in you would think the same thing. Not the case. Yes the deer are stupid. The hunt takes place during extended bow and again during winter bow. After the first few deer are harvested they get almost a leary as deer in a normal place. In addition to that there is more of them so there are more sets of eyes to bust you.
